By DEREK GATOPOULOS, THEODORA TONGAS and MAURICIO SAVARESE, Associated Press
ATHENS, Greece (AP) — U.S. Energy Secretary Chris Wright on Friday condemned the COP30 environmental summit as harmful and misguided — defying the global scientific consensus and concern by governments worldwide on climate change.
“It’s essentially a hoax. It’s not an honest organization looking to better human lives,” Wright told The Associated Press at the close of a two-day business conference in Athens. He added that he might attend next year’s summit “just to try to deliver some common sense.”
